A Better Plan: Winning the Peace in Afghanistan

President Obama announced his 10 year plan for Afghanistan. It includes an additional 21,000 U.S. military forces deployed in Iraq and diplomatic engagement of Pakistan. He is still trying to force political and social change through the Pentagon.

We have a better plan: focus on diplomatic cooperation and humanitarian aid, mitigate civilian causalities by scaling back military force.

The United Nations, U.S. and British generals, peace groups, and 19 members of Congress agree:

“The war in Afghanistan cannot be won militarily and success is only possible through political means including dialogue between all relevant parties.”
